Canadian Folk Singer Meets Tragic Death

Posted: 31 Oct 2009 08:00 AM PDT

Toronto-based folk singer 's promising career came to a tragic end on this Wednesday due to mortal wounds from a surprising Coyote attack. cover

It was said she was on a solo hike in Cape Breton Highlands National Park in Nova Scotia. Coyotes, being naturally shy creatures, may have mistaken her for deer or other prey said Wildlife biologist Bob Bancroft. Other hiker's in the area heard Mitchell’s screams and alerted emergency police dispatchers.

Mitchell had been traveling on her first tour promoting her debut LP For Your Consideration. She was also nominated for Young Performer of the Year honors by the Canadian Folk Music Awards, which will be awarded in November. She has performed in festivals that included , Neko Case and .

On Taylor's last post on FaceBook, Mitchell described playing at someone's home as "a welcome dose of normality after a whirlwind weekend” at the Ontario Council of Folk Music.

Michael Johnston, her Producer of For Your Consideration said he and his family would soon be organizing a celebration of her life.
